Jonathan Rosenberg is the Chief Technology Strategist at Skype,[1][2] where he is responsible for shaping and driving the company's technology strategies and overall architecture.

Jonathan is active with the IETF. He was the Co-Author of the Session Initiation Protocol (SIP).[3] He is one of the most prolific authors of Internet standards, having written 56 RFCs. He was a member of the IAB for 2 years (2004-2006).[4]

Jonathan was also a Member of the IANA.[5]

Mr. Rosenberg recieved his Bachelors and Masters Degrees from MIT, and PhD from Columbia University.

Career History

  • Cisco Fellow at Cisco Systems
  • CTO at dynamicsoft
  • Member of Technical Staff at Lucent Technologies

Awards

  • Pulver Von Pioneer award for contributions to the VoIP industry
  • Technology Review Magazine's TR100 - the 100 most innovative technologists in the world under the age of 35[6]
  • CRN Magazine's "Super Geeks" - 10 engineers who are casting larger-than-life shadows over the industry
  • TMC Internet Telephony Magazine's Top 100 Voices of IP communications[7]
